It started out as a good set of tools to make working a project easier. Now they have a manager of the ITC PMO, a person who has never successfully managed a project, who has been instrumental in adding layer of layer of overhead and required activities, in order to micomanage a project. He thinks an IT project should be run the same way PRC manages their capital projects. It is absurd to require a project to fill out a bunch of forms that add no value to the project. They need to go back to where it was 5 or 6 years ago.

Methodologies are valuable when they insure consistency and prevent people from wasting time reinventing the wheel, but Chevron uses methodology as a substitute for developing and rewarding competence. I was in a small technical sub-specialty within IT. While management said they supported our team and our mission, they were convinced that we could get the job done by providing templates and checklists for people who did not have experience, training, or interest in our field of expertise. I believe we just created another layer of low value add work for an army of already exhausted template zombies.
